The Corona Virus and Pregnancy

So, how does the Corona Virus affect you if you are pregnant? Actually, as with so much about this disease, it is so new that not much is known. Based on the available information about the virus, it seems as if pregnant women face the same risks as anyone else, no more and no less.

What age can you have sex in Nebraska or Iowa?

Each state has set a certain age limit for when young people can have sex. Below that age, the state assumes that the boy or girl is not old enough to give permission for sex. In other words, it is assumed that they do not understand what having sex means and need to be protected.
